The average bar steward gross salary in Næstved, Denmark is 240.968 kr. or an equivalent hourly rate of 116 kr.. This is 6% lower (-14.760 kr.) than the average bar steward salary in Denmark. In addition, they earn an average bonus of 13.301 kr.. Salary estimates based on salary survey data collected directly from employers and anonymous employees in Næstved, Denmark. An entry level bar steward (1-3 years of experience) earns an average salary of 211.639 kr.. On the other end, a senior level bar steward (8+ years of experience) earns an average salary of 282.157 kr..
